The general idea is, that we have a simple mechanism that ... WebSep 15, 2024 · The Windows operating system allows semaphores to have names. A named semaphore is system wide. That is, once the named semaphore is created, it is visible to all threads in all processes. Thus, named semaphore can be used to synchronize the activities of processes as well as threads.

In computer science, a semaphore is a variable or abstract data type used to control access to a common resource by multiple threads and avoid critical section problems in a concurrent system such as a multitasking operating system. Semaphores are a type of synchronization primitive. A trivial semaphore is a plain variable that is changed (for example, incremented or decremented, or to…
